Ensure your marine engine is running at peak efficiency and safety with the advanced 18-32153 Oxygen Sensor. This critical component plays a vital role in monitoring exhaust gases, allowing your engine control unit to make real-time adjustments for optimal fuel combustion and emissions control. | Specification | Value |
|---|---|
| MFG Number | 18-32153 |
| Product Type | Oxygen Sensor |
| Application | Marine Engine |
| Material | Corrosion-resistant metal and ceramic |
| Operating Temperature Range | -40°C to 1200°C |
| Voltage | 12V |
| Thread Size | M18 x 1.5 |
| Connector Type | Standard marine connector |
| Weight | Approx. 0.2 lbs |
